Output fa715fc6a6852129eb21ef9bf4e20d28ee79ad5e9481d6059a4d7f7803e84ec6:1

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ba853058fb252fd761b8d6bd4fc7171a910509 OP_EQUAL
address
31wSiam8eynPXrPw5B3RrLq61WXTL9UbQU
transaction
fa715fc6a6852129eb21ef9bf4e20d28ee79ad5e9481d6059a4d7f7803e84ec6
confirmations
541511
spent
true